RAJOURI, APRIL 21: District Development Commissioner, Dr. Shahid Iqbal Choudhary today held detailed review of developmental works being executed by different departments in eco-tourism Park Patli Qila and Amusement Park Koteranka in a meeting of concerned officers.

The meeting was attended by Additional Deputy Commissioner Shafiq Ahmed, ACD Noor Alam, Xen PHE Nisar Khan, Xen PWD Mushtaq Raina, Chief Horticulture Officer Mohammad Younis, AD Fisheries Shafiq Wani, Development Officer Sericulture and BDO Koteranka Imtiaz Ahmed.

Assistant Commissioner Development, Noor Alam presented a resume of developmental activities including construction of approach road, service road, tracks, fountains, entrance gate, chain link fencing of 276 Kanal of land of eco-park, water bodies, nurseries of Horticulture, Agriculture and Forest Departments, huts and guest house and other assets in eco-tourism Park Patli Qila apart from developmental works in amusement park at Koteranka.

Dr Shahid held detailed review of ongoing works on various sections of Park being developed as Herbal Garden, Cactus Garden, Children Amusement Park, Residential log huts, botanical garden, water reservoirs, tracking paths and trails apart from plantation of ornamental saplings and flower beds. He directed the concerned to expedite the execution of work so that park can been thrown open for public and educational tour of students from colleges and universities of state.

It was decided that the Xen PWD shall ensure functioning of approach road, service road and main gate within a month time. The BDO was directed coordinate with departments for development of fish ponds, nurseries, flower beds, preservation and beautification of years old spring that exists in the park area besides immediate start of work on guest house and tourism huts.

Pertinently Eco-Park is being developed as first of its kind with resources converged from more than 15 departments and it will serve as destination for eco-tourism, children excursions, study tours, home-stays, amusement and different other activities. Special components are being designed for educational values particularly about local flora and fauna.

The DDC also directed the BDO to execute work on various compartments of amusement park at Koteranka so as to complete the project in stipulated time.
